Google Home
Google Home

Description: Google Home is a smart speaker developed by Google. It uses Google Assistant to respond to voice commands and play music, control smart home devices, provide information, set alarms and timers, and more.

Google Home
Google Home
Pros
  • Powerful and accurate voice recognition
  • Seamless integration with other Google services
  • Large knowledge graph for answering questions
  • Works with many smart home devices
  • Good sound quality
  • Compact design
Cons
  • Requires constant internet connection
  • Limited third-party app integration
  • Privacy concerns around always-listening device
  • Hardware reliability issues reported by some users
